
Cloudflare开放测试新的容器(Containers)服务,这项服务目前适用于所有付费用户,并主打与Cloudflare Workers运算服务高度整合,强调部署流程简易、全球分布高运算弹性为主要特点。Cloudflare逐步扩展其开发者平台,让过去仅能在Workers执行的运算,现在也能透过Containers部署支援更广泛的应用情境,包括多语言后端服务、影音与资料处理、批次任务与CLI工具等。
Cloudflare Containers让用户只需撰写少量设定与程序码,透过Wrangler工具一键部署,即可将容器映像档部署至Cloudflare全球节点,并由平台自动挑选最佳地点,数秒即可启动容器。与传统云端容器服务需手动管理多区域组态或调度策略不同,Cloudflare Containers支援全球部署,开发者无需考量区域配置即可就近服务全球用户,实现低延迟且自动扩展的运算架构。
在使用情境方面,Cloudflare Containers特别适合需要隔离执行环境的应用,如执行用户自订程序码、人工智慧推论沙箱、影片转档或资料处理等。开发者可于Wrangler设定档指定本地Dockerfile或现有映像档,设定如埠口、闲置自动休眠时间与最大执行个体数。运作过程中,Containers可由Workers程序动态控制执行个体启动与请求路由,开发者能根据工作负载与请求逻辑灵活调度,利用Cloudflare的全球资源。
可观测性与管理也是该服务的重点,Cloudflare Containers在管理介面内建即时监控与日誌查询,开发者可随时追蹤资源使用情形,日誌则可保留7天或串接至外部平台,协助除错与维运。
Cloudflare Containers按用量计费,依每10毫秒实际用量计价,分别针对记忆体、CPU、储存空间与网路流量收费,且每月内含免费额度。不同地区的流量价格有所不同,超过后则依照流量进行计价。官方同步提供多种资源规格,包括dev、basic与standard执行个体,最高可达4 GiB记忆体与半颗虚拟CPU。